11# This file implements regression tests for SQLite library.
12#
13# This file implements tests to make sure SQLite does not crash or
14# segfault if it sees a corrupt database file.  It specifically focuses
15# on loops in the B-Tree structure. A loop is formed in a B-Tree structure
16# when there exists a page that is both an a descendent or ancestor of
17# itself.
18#
19# Also test that an SQLITE_CORRUPT error is returned if a B-Tree page
20# contains a (corrupt) reference to a page greater than the configured
21# maximum page number.
